Runbook: Crumbline order-cutoff enforcement. Orders for next-day pickup close at 18:00 shop-local time; the cutoff job revokes the checkout token and locks the order queue. From a security standpoint, note that the token revocation and the queue lock are separate operations — if the lock step fails, expired tokens could still be replayed against the order endpoint. Verify both steps completed in the audit log. The full verification procedure is on the internal page below.

dashboard of tahop-fahof = https://harbor.tolvaqnet.example/secrets/merge_requests/board/issue/merge_requests/pipeline/secrets/ecb30ed86a55c001a77f6cb9

FeedCheck validates podcast RSS feeds before publish. Clone the repo, run the test suite, then point the validator at the staging feed. Failures block release; warnings do not. Most issues are malformed enclosure tags. Read the ruleset doc before touching validation logic. For access or onboarding questions, reach the FeedCheck maintainers here.

escalation mailbox, bafog-fafog: ulador@paliqlabs.internal

Minutes — Management Meeting, Launch Plan for Brindlewave 3

Present: H. Castellor, M. Ryn, D. Aubrecht. The launch of Brindlewave 3 by Ferrowind Labs was reviewed in detail. Demo units ship to regional teams two weeks before release; pricing sheets follow one week later. M. Ryn will confirm readiness of the Tallowmere support desk. Channel messaging remains embargoed until the launch date. Sales leads must treat the item below as strictly confidential within this circle.

confidential, kajof-tahof: The pricing group signed off on a budget of $491.8 million for Project Casvan.

Subject: Cold starts on Fernloop handlers — better now

Hi — quick release note: the Fernloop serverless handlers were cold-starting at nearly four seconds after the runtime bump. We trimmed the dependency bundle and pre-warmed the hot paths; p95 is back under 900ms. Safe to proceed with the cut. The candidate build is below.

build token for kagaf-hahof: htk14_9d3d4d26d7d8de